// This file is a snapshot of an AIDL file. Do not edit it manually. There are
// two cases:
// 1). this is a frozen version file - do not edit this in any case.
// 2). this is a 'current' file. If you make a backwards compatible change to
// the interface (from the latest frozen version), the build system will
// prompt you to update this file with `m <name>-update-api`.
//
// You must not make a backward incompatible change to any AIDL file built
// with the aidl_interface module type with versions property set. The module
// type is used to build AIDL files in a way that they can be used across
// independently updatable components of the system. If a device is shipped
// with such a backward incompatible change, it has a high risk of breaking
// later when a module using the interface is updated, e.g., Mainline modules.
package android.hardware.radio.satellite;
/* @hide */
@VintfStability
interface IRadioSatelliteResponse {
oneway void acknowledgeRequest(in int serial);
oneway void addAllowedSatelliteContactsRes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void getCapabilitiesResponse(in android.hardware.radio.RadioResponseInfo info, in android.hardware.radio.satellite.SatelliteCapabilities capabilities);
oneway void getMaxCharactersPerTextMessageResponse(in android.hardware.radio.RadioResponseInfo info, in int charLimit);
oneway void getPendingMessagesResponse(in android.hardware.radio.RadioResponseInfo info, in String[] messages);
oneway void getPowerStateResponse(in android.hardware.radio.RadioResponseInfo info, in boolean on);
oneway void getSatelliteModeResponse(in android.hardware.radio.RadioResponseInfo info, in android.hardware.radio.satellite.SatelliteMode mode, in android.hardware.radio.satellite.NTRadioTechnology technology);
oneway void getTimeForNextSatelliteVisibilityResponse(in android.hardware.radio.RadioResponseInfo info, in int timeInSeconds);
oneway void provisionServiceResponse(in android.hardware.radio.RadioResponseInfo info, in boolean provisioned);
oneway void removeAllowedSatelliteContactsRes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void sendMessagesRes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void setIndicationFilterRes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void setPowerRes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void startSendingSatellitePointingInfoResponse(in android.hardware.radio.RadioResponseInfo info);
oneway void stopSendingSatellitePointingInfoResponse(in android.hardware.radio.RadioResponseInfo info);
}
